Problem

Conventional software applications fail to preserve and access document-based workspaces, leading to loss of transient data when switching between different computing devices or sessions, which is crucial for editing and collaboration on electronic documents.

Innovation Solution

A method and system for managing portable document-based workspaces by identifying and saving transient data associated with a document using a defined data structure, allowing the workspace to be saved and accessed from different devices via a cloud service component, ensuring that the editing state and context are preserved across sessions and locations.

AI summary

In various embodiments, methods and systems for managing portable document-based workspaces is provided. An indication to save a document-based workspace for a document is received on a computing device. The computing device can include a software application for editing the document and a client application for communicating with a cloud service component that is configured to store the document and the document-based workspace. Based on receiving the indication to save the document-based workspace, transient data associated with the document is identified. The transient data can be identified based on a data structure that defines document-specific data that are preserved as part of the document-based workspace. The document-based workspace is saved and communicated to the cloud service component such that the transient data associated with the document is accessible when the document is accessed from a second computing device that sends an indication to access the document and the document-based workspace.
